软件编写流程

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

软件编写流程
软件编写是一个复杂而又精密的过程,它需要经历多个阶段的
设计、开发、测试和发布。

在整个软件编写流程中,每个阶段都有
其独特的重要性,而且相互之间存在着密切的联系和依赖。

下面将
详细介绍软件编写的流程及其各个阶段的特点和要点。

首先,软件编写的第一个阶段是需求分析。

在这个阶段,开发
人员需要与客户充分沟通,了解客户的需求和期望。

通过需求分析,开发人员可以清晰地了解软件的功能和特性,为后续的设计和开发
工作奠定基础。

接下来是软件设计阶段。

在这个阶段,开发人员需要根据需求
分析的结果,进行软件架构的设计和模块的划分。

同时,还需要制
定详细的设计文档,包括软件界面设计、数据库设计、算法设计等
内容。

良好的软件设计是软件编写成功的关键。

然后是软件开发阶段。

在这个阶段,开发人员需要根据设计文档,利用相应的编程语言和开发工具进行编码工作。

在编码过程中,需要注重代码的规范和质量,同时需要进行代码的测试和调试,确
保代码的稳定性和可靠性。

紧接着是软件测试阶段。

在这个阶段,测试人员需要对软件进
行全面的测试,包括功能测试、性能测试、安全测试等。

通过测试,可以发现和解决软件中存在的各种问题和bug,确保软件的质量和
稳定性。

最后是软件发布阶段。

在这个阶段,软件开发团队需要将经过
测试和验证的软件版本发布给客户,并提供相应的技术支持和维护。

同时,还需要不断收集用户的反馈意见,为软件的后续优化和升级
提供参考。

总的来说,软件编写流程是一个系统性的工程,需要经过需求
分析、设计、开发、测试和发布等多个阶段。

在每个阶段,都需要
开发人员和测试人员的密切合作,以确保软件的质量和用户体验。

同时,还需要注重软件的可维护性和可扩展性,为软件的后续升级
和优化留下空间。

只有严格按照软件编写流程进行,才能保证软件
开发的顺利进行和最终的成功发布。

相关文档
最新文档